roymondchen
|
89f863d873
|
fix: 当前选中组件处于流式布局模式下时,直接拖动其他组件会错误判断成是流式组件
|
2022-07-25 22:02:17 +08:00 |
|
roymondchen
|
0e0e3ee310
|
refactor: 使用@element-plus/icons-vue替换@element-plus/icons
|
2022-07-14 20:39:11 +08:00 |
|
roymondchen
|
de0c6952c7
|
feat: 支持将组件拖动到指定容器
|
2022-07-14 19:02:29 +08:00 |
|
roymondchen
|
e901ad4dd0
|
feat(editor): 添加props-panel-header slot;修改layer-panel,component-list-panel slot名称,加上-header
|
2022-07-08 17:37:04 +08:00 |
|
roymondchen
|
49c9e87d6e
|
feat(editor): 添加layer-panel/component-list-panel slot
|
2022-07-07 19:46:11 +08:00 |
|
roymondchen
|
70292b92c8
|
feat(editor): contentmenu支持扩展
|
2022-06-06 15:28:47 +08:00 |
|
roymondchen
|
d02e044293
|
refactor(editor): tabpane prop type
|
2022-05-27 18:48:55 +08:00 |
|
roymondchen
|
2731609526
|
fix: 升级element-plus2.2.0后,sidebar动态变化后,顺序不对
|
2022-05-13 20:45:31 +08:00 |
|
roymondchen
|
1486beb52c
|
fix: 升级element-plus2.2.0后,button默认样式变化
|
2022-05-13 20:45:31 +08:00 |
|
roymondchen
|
d1610e5ff2
|
style(editor): 菜单样式优化
|
2022-05-07 15:18:29 +08:00 |
|
roymondchen
|
bcbd1f5d37
|
fix(editor): 删除组件后,组件树不更新
|
2022-05-07 15:18:29 +08:00 |
|
roymondchen
|
5da8601f36
|
feat(editor): 支持拖拽添加组件
|
2022-05-07 15:18:29 +08:00 |
|
roymondchen
|
56375b0fb0
|
refactor(editor): 重构右键菜单
|
2022-05-05 20:33:10 +08:00 |
|
roymondchen
|
992ebbe3ce
|
fix(editor): 修复新增组件时,组件列表配置的数据丢失问题
|
2022-04-13 17:17:14 +08:00 |
|
roymondchen
|
f896115881
|
feat(editor): 组件树保持展开当前选中节点的父节点
|
2022-04-07 18:31:37 +08:00 |
|
roymondchen
|
8390ba75be
|
fix(editor): 从组件树选中没有渲染的组件时,需要等待组件渲染完成再初始化选中框
|
2022-04-07 18:31:37 +08:00 |
|
roymondchen
|
97a722579d
|
feat(editor): 组件树增加id和type过滤
|
2022-04-02 20:14:45 +08:00 |
|
roymondchen
|
a842c5b0ce
|
feat: 优化拖拽体验
|
2022-04-02 12:56:54 +08:00 |
|
roymondchen
|
be4df0fc9b
|
fix(editor): 组件树右键菜单子菜单出不来
|
2022-04-01 16:56:59 +08:00 |
|
roymondchen
|
6dbda7b565
|
style(editor): 将节点类型改成枚举
|
2022-03-31 19:46:12 +08:00 |
|
parisma
|
feb9ac9a81
|
feat: 编辑器支持鼠标悬停高亮组件
|
2022-03-31 15:16:32 +08:00 |
|
roymondchen
|
bc8b9f5225
|
refactor: make it public
|
2022-02-17 14:47:39 +08:00 |
|